I have had 2 heart attacks and have spent many weeks on the Heart Floor at my hospital. During that time I met numerous patients that "had their chests cracked open, several of my good friends, 1 of which was 83 when he had his Aortic Valve replaced. Within 3 months, he was back ice skating with me.

 

You don't "know any", I know so many that I have lost count that recovered just fine, many older than your sister. If she is in good physical shape(other than her heart), she should recover just fine, assuming she follows all her recovery instructions from her doctor(s).

Prayers to your sister, and esp you and your family. I had aortic aneurysm removed and valve replacement. This was in 2014. I too had my chest plate 'cracked open'. I healed perfectly fine...I was very nervous about that but no problems. I feel the best I ever have, walk 5 miles a day.  I think the key was sitting up all the time, even to sleep. I did that for 2 months. My Dr. said the best thing to do was walk, little each day, for full recovery.
